I applied for a $120000.00 fixed rate 15y mortgage with - % down with The Money Store on -/-/-. We spoke about closing -/-/15 but did not since the commitment was issued -/-/-. I submitted all documents requested -/-/15. The contracted closing date was -/-/15, which they also now missed. Since submitting all my requested documents on -/-/-, The Money Store has continued to delay the closing requesting unreasonable documents, not originally requested. Each time I submit documents, they come back with yet another request. For example, there are beneficiaries listed on my bank accounts and The Money Store demanded that I obtain a letter from the bank stating my beneficiaries can not withdraw any money from the account. Once I submitted that bank letter, then they asked that my beneficiaries sign something to the same effect. Another example is The Money Store requesting me to contact the title company I sent a wire to requesting the copy of the cashed check for the money I gave to my mother to pay the balance due on the purchase of her home -/-/-!
